We are looking for an experienced Receptionist to join our Wentworth campus (JK-Grade 7). As the “Director of First Impressions”, the Receptionist is responsible for delivering the highest level of customer service in a professional and positive manner. The role also oversees the natural flow and efficiency of the office, manages multiple projects and delivers clear communication to faculty, staff, parents and guests.

We are hiring for a Temporary Contract position from April 14, 2025 to June 30, 2025, and a Permanent Full-Time position that will start August 22, 2025. If applicants are interested in both positions, please share this preference in your job application.

Responsibilities

Reception & Guest Services:

  • Welcome and assist faculty, staff, parents, and guests to the building.
  • Respond to general inquiries over phone, e-mail, and in person.
  • Manage active switchboard (answer phones and voicemails, respond to and direct calls accordingly).
  • Monitor all sign-in/sign-out procedures for students, staff, faculty, and visitors at the school.
  • Manage meeting room bookings.
  • Organize reserved guest parking signage.
  • Maintain out of hours, holidays telephone forwarding message system.

Administrative & Record Keeping:

  • Manage, maintain files and reference documents using Microsoft Office and G Suite.
  • Manage day to day student attendance: check attendance emails and input notes to student attendance files, follow up with parents and staff on unexcused absences, and complete the year-end Ministry Audit each year.
  • Work with Human Resources to manage and maintain a volunteer database for all Wentworth Volunteers.
  • Maintain manifests for all school trips and follow up when necessary.
  • Maintain emergency preparedness documents.
  • Maintain building emergency protocols, supplies, and kits held at reception.
  • Other seasonal related duties which may include distribution of yearbooks, accepting cheques from parents, etc.
  • Additional duties as required.

Operations & Logistics:

  • Work with IT on the Visitor Management System.
  • Order school supplies for the beginning of each school year as well as stationery supplies as needed throughout the school year.
  • Update and maintain classroom signage.
  • Liaison to Maintenance and cleaning staff for urgent requests.
  • Coordinate all incoming and outgoing inter-office mail.
  • Work with the Transportation Manager to facilitate school bus ticket sales and float.
  • Maintain the cleanliness and order of the lost and found area and organize for parent volunteers to display and donate items.
